The video explores the Document Based Question (DBQ) section of the AP U.S. History exam, focusing on the social and economic experiences of African Americans moving from the South to the North between 1910 and 1930. It analyzes primary documents, including a folk saying, a migrant's letter, an industrial management article, and a race riot newspaper article. The video highlights the challenges faced by African Americans, such as economic hardship, segregation, and racism, and sets the stage for developing a thesis statement in the next video.
